As a firm support coordinator, you will work with the support team to provide a variety of administrative services necessary to keep a professional services firm functioning. You will work as part of our front desk team to support the firm’s team members and clients in our Downtown Austin office. Overtime maybe occasionally required during peak periods.
Responsibilities- Ensure that the office is clean and ready for guests at all times
- Answer and direct incoming phone calls
- Welcome and direct any visitors or clients
- Receive and distribute incoming mail and deliveries
- Process outgoing mail, including taking certified mail to the post office as needed
- Monitor and distribute e-faxes
- Respond to email requests in a professional, timely manner (individual and shared inbox)
- Assist with catering setup and clean up as needed
- Serve as backup in stocking office and breakroom supplies
- Coordinate building access for employees, including requesting and deactivating access cards
- Data entry and management in the firm’s practice management and CRM systems
- Assist associates and partners in preparing documents for distribution
- Assist all associates, partners, and clients by providing a variety of administrative support including regularly assigned duties and other tasks as assigned
- Provide backup to other support team members as needed, including occasional backup for our Round Rock front desk
- Participate in support team meetings and contribute to ongoing process improvement
- 2-3 years of relevant work experience (experience at a CPA or professional services firm is a plus, but will consider other in-person customer service/hospitality experience coupled with administrative skills)
- Must be able to work in-person in our downtown Austin office Monday through Friday, 8am – 5pm
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(including Excel) and Adobe Acrobat
- Experience inputting and managing data in CRM and practice management systems (Hub Spot and CCH Axcess experience is a plus)
- Highly motivated team player
- Superior organization and project management skills with proven ability to be detail-oriented, appropriately prioritise tasks and meet deadlines
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to work well both independently and with others to help accomplish the overall mission and goals of the firm
- Ability to provide a high level of customer service
- Ability to adapt to changes in the work environment, including managing competing demands and dealing with frequent change, interruptions, or unexpected events
- Excellent problem-solving skills
- Ability to maintain a high level of confidentiality
